文档介绍:该【市政府多媒体查询系统的设计与实现 】是由【286919636】上传分享,文档一共【5】页,该文档可以免费在线阅读,需要了解更多关于【市政府多媒体查询系统的设计与实现 】的内容,可以使用淘豆网的站内搜索功能,选择自己适合的文档,以下文字是截取该文章内的部分文字,如需要获得完整电子版,请下载此文档到您的设备,方便您编辑和打印。市政府多媒体查询系统的设计与实现
摘 要 本系统针对本地数据库查询用户所需信息,采用Browser/Server结构,将文字、图形、图像、动画等媒体进行数据的采集,对采集的初态数据加以组织和管理,最后通过程序语言达到有机的结合,从而实现多媒体信息查询系统的功能。本系统可作为电子政务系统的分支项目。 关键词 B/S结构;电子政务;Authorware;ASP
1 引言 电子政务始于20世纪80年代初[1],它彻底改变了传统政务工作模式。实施电子政务系统以后,政府机构可以利用先进的计算机网络技术为公众提供更优质的服务。如上访信息管理系统能够帮助各级党政机关更方便地与社会公众进行沟通,及时听取反馈意见;项目申报系统则可以方便社会公众上报信息,避免手工方式下要往返多次才能按要求提供全部所需材料的弊病,使政府机构为社会公众提供更好的服务。 本系统作为电子政务系统处理公共事务的助手,它主要采用Authorware、平面设计、数据库等技术开发而成,能给社会公众提供政务信息了解、政策法规查询、办事指南等功能。
2 系统总体结构 多媒体查询系统主要面向社会公众,就要求操作一定要简便,主页面要展示所有提供的服务。本系统的功能结构图如图1所示。图1 系统功能结构图
3 系统模块介绍
政务信息浏览 此模块主要提供信息服务,公民可以直接触摸查询政务信息,操作十分简单便利。由于政务信息更新频繁,故需采用数据库来存储和维护。 虽然Authorware利用系统提供的ODBC结合SQL可以完成对数据库的操作,但仅限于使用本地的数据库,这样就给Authorware的网络开发带来了很大的局限性。同时因为多媒体系统一般置于大厅或室外,所以政务信息数据的更新和维护都需要专人收集,然后特意到多媒体查询系统主机上去更新。 我们知道很多网站都是用Active Server Page+Access技术构建而成,最初想到的是直接用Web插件调用ASP网页来实现数据库的远程操作,但这样又无法发挥Authorware强大交互功能。 于是构建了这样一个方案,在多媒体查询系统所在主机上建立本地数据库,同时建立虚拟目录以及配置本地Web服务,这样就可以实现工作人员在办公室用网站通过ADO更新数据库,具体结构如图2所示。图2 信息更新
政策法规查询 该模块数据库内容包括了大部分的有关劳动关系、就业和培训、劳动报酬与福利、失业保险、养老保险、医疗保险、社会保险基金监督管理、其它保险、劳动保障监察与争议仲裁、劳动保护、社会事务与管理、法制工作等方面的法律、法规、政策性文件以及与劳动保障工作相关的重要的行政、经济等法律、法规共300多篇,后续法规每年加载。软件简便易用、实用性很强,查询功能灵活、简单。
其它模块 处室职能、办公楼平面图、办事指南这三个模块能对进入市政府办事人员进行指引,减少他们滞留市政府的时间,提高办事效率。这三个模块不易更新,所以无须经常访问数据库,设计出合适的文档和图片,采用Authorware集成即可。
4 系统技术要点
Authorware访问数据库 Authorware访问数据库可以分为两个阶段:连接数据库和操作数据库。 1)连接数据库 Authorware本身没有数据库接口,不能直接访问数据库,但可以通过设置ODBC接口连接数据库,具体操作 使用控制面板中的ODBC管理程序手动建立:打开“控制面板”→“管理工具”→“数据源(ODBC)”,选择“用户DSN”选项卡,添加数据源。 2)操作数据库 在Authorware中对数据库的操作主要是通过中的三个函数来实现的,这三个函数分别是ODBCOpen函数、ODBCExecute函数、ODBCClose函数。
ASP技术访问数据库 系统实现了信息办公室采用Web形式进行政务、政策、法规等信息的更新。这些功能是采用ASP技术通过ADO及IIS(Internet Information Service)技术实现的。这里连接数据库的方法如下(以SQLServer为例):%set conn = ("")"Provider=SQLOLEDB;ID=sa;PWD=;database=test;datasource=localhost"%
平面设计技术 本系统还有一个特色就是每一个界面都是精心设计,设计的主题必须与政府形象相结合起来,它主要采用PhotoShop和CoreDraw两款软件设计而成。
5 系统待改进的地方 市政府多媒体查询系统是本人一个科技创新项目,已经有相应的软件研发出来。系统有一个问题还待解决,那就是如何使用Authorware编程来远程访问数据库,同时又不影响系统的交互性。如果能简便的实现用Authorware远程访问数据库,我们就可以不采用ASP技术和无须配置多媒体系统所在主机的Web服务了。
参考文献[1] 熊李艳,黎海生,谢剑,猛许飞. 基于J2EE的电子政务系统的设计与实现. 微计算机信息. 2006/36 洪运锡. ASP技术访问Web数据库 . 贵州大学学报. 2006/2 邓椿志.基础与实例教程[M].北京:电子工业出版杜,2005 郝耀辉. 用Authorware结合Access制作习题课件 中国现代教育装备. 2007/4